0.35.0
Breaking Changes
- Add MSC prefix to progress bar suppression environment variable (
SUPPRESS_PROGRESS_BAR→MSC_SUPPRESS_PROGRESS_BAR). - Remove
msc globcommand.
New Features
This release introduces a Model Context Protocol (MCP) server for the MSC. See the documentation for more details.
- Add Model Context Protocol (MCP) server.
- Allow overwrites in
ManifestMetadataProvider. Introduce logical/physical path separation. - Make
profilesoptional in MSC configs. - Add
discard()in thePosixFileto clean up the temporary file when the atomic write is enabled. - Use
CredentialProviderinterface in Rust client. - Add Google service account credentials provider for GCS storage provider.
- Add AWS SDK/CLI external credentials process credentials provider for S3 storage providers.
Bug Fixes
- Move progress bar output from stdout to stderr.
- Parse timestamps from AIStore.